2013 KPW to BDT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2013

During 2013, the KPW to BDT ex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on January 2, valuing the pair at 0.0890.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on September 8, dropping to 0.0857.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0033 BDT.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.0885 to the December average rate of 0.0863, the exchange rate registered a net change of -2.52% (reflecting a weakening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2013 high of 0.0890 was down 5.33% compared to the 2012 peak of 0.0940,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 0.0890 0.0881 0.0885
February 0.0884 0.0869 0.0876
March 0.0884 0.0867 0.0874
April 0.0871 0.0863 0.0867
May 0.0870 0.0863 0.0867
June 0.0871 0.0860 0.0865
July 0.0868 0.0858 0.0865
August 0.0867 0.0861 0.0864
September 0.0866 0.0857 0.0862
October 0.0864 0.0860 0.0863
November 0.0865 0.0861 0.0863
December 0.0866 0.0861 0.0863
